The Basque Government buys 1% of the company Enagás for around EUR 45 million
This acquisition is the first direct investment made through Indartuz.
Enagás Company headquarters. Stock Photo: Open
The Basque Government has acquired 1% of the equity capital of the company Enagásthrough the Basque Institute of Finance (IVF), as reported on Wednesday by the Department of Finance in a statement, an operation that has been carried out through the company Indartuz, a financial instrument promoted within the framework of the Euskadi Eraldatuz 2030 Plan.
This acquisition is the first direct investment made through the Indartuz tool. Although no figures have been provided on the transaction, bearing in mind that the stock market capitalization of Enagás is currently 4.5 billion euros , the Basque Government has paid about 45 million euros for 1%.
The Basque Government considers it a "strategic investment in energy autonomy and security of energy supply as a key asset. "
Enagas has a critical infrastructure for the operation of the energy system and for ensuring energy supply in the Basque Country. In addition, will play a key role in the deployment of the main green hydrogennetwork and the European H2Med corridor.
